

Mr. Johnson was born in Alexandria and lived there his entire life, graduating from Alexandria High School in 1958. He served in the U.S. Army Reserves and retired as Supervisor of Construction at the Anniston Water Department after 30 years of employment. As a Deacon at Post Oak Springs Baptist Church he provided many years of service to God.
Mr. Johnson was a wonderful father and husband, and a fun-loving gentleman with a servant's heart and a love for life. His tremendous work ethic was evident in everything he did. He loved hunting, being outdoors and enjoying music with others. He also enjoyed gardening and sharing the fruits of his labor with neighbors and friends. He was most at home when surrounded by his family. Most importantly, he was a faithful servant of God.
